Food training is used for lots of training. Service dogs, that are used by military, police, or handicap, are mostly done with food reward, though if course you pet them and other rewards are included. Many dont even get their meals with out doing some sort of obedient training, (very quick). Food is just part of yhe training not the be all and end all.

The problem is not the food, its the consistancy. A dog isnt born knowing how to beg its taught. Most people dont even realize they are doing it, because the human is the one conditioned with the improper behavior. Oh look how cute you are here is a carrot every time they open the fridge. What kind of food you train with maters though as some have chemicals that make the dog want more, just like human snackfood that has crap that give cravings.

Dog training for most cases is about training the human, dogs are pure and corupted by people. They do have minds of their own, but they are not like kids that can take 10x the effort and still not behave. A dog is born wanting to listen and please, its just how they evolved. Of course high energy breeds need more work in the beging just because the dog needs more direction on how to focus its energy.

Good traing is all about consistency. If you ever notice a very well trained dog always looks at its handler first, its genetic.
